Ulnar deviation can occur due to chronic inflammation from rheumatoid arthritis(RA). RA is a chronic inflammatory disease in which the body’s immune system attacks the soft tissue or synovium that lines the surface of joints. RA often affects the synovium between small joints in the hands and wrists, … See more Lupus is an autoimmune disease that can affect any part of the body, including the joints, skin, and organs. WebWhen you down-hinge your wrist to hit the nail with the hammer, that is "ulnar deviation" of the wrist (so called because you're bending it toward the ulnar bone).
